What is the value of the expression below? (27^2/3)^1/2 Please explain!!

Answer:

3

Step-by-step explanation:

First deal with the brackets

27^2/3 can be written as

( \sqrt[3]{27} ) ^{2 }

which simplifies to 3^2

which is 9

so now you have (9)^1/2

which is also written as

\sqrt{9}

which is 3

What two numbers are located 1/2 of a unit from 1/6 on a number line?
ella [17]

Answer:

2/3 and -1/3

Step-by-step explanation:

We have to find which two numbers on the number line are at a distance of 1/2 from 1/6.

The two numbers that are 1/2 units away from 1/6 will be:

1) \frac{1}{6}+\frac{1}{2}\\\\ =\frac{1}{6}+\frac{3}{6}\\\\ =\frac{4}{6}\\\\=\frac{2}{3}

2) \frac{1}{6}-\frac{1}{2}\\\\ =\frac{1}{6}-\frac{3}{6}\\\\ =\frac{-2}{6}\\\\ =\frac{-1}{3}

Thus the two numbers are: 2/3 and -1/3
